Administrative Assistant – Work From Home

Location: UK Wide (Remote / Home Based)

Salary: £11 – £15 per hour (£21,450 – £29,250 per annum equivalent, based on a 37.5-hour week)

Job Type: Full-Time (Part-Time options also available)

About the Opportunity

Vita CV is currently recruiting on behalf of our client, an established UK business looking to appoint a reliable Administrative Assistant to support their day-to-day operations. This is a UK-wide remote position suited to candidates with prior administrative experience who can work accurately and independently from home.

About the Role

The Administrative Assistant will support a range of internal administrative functions including document management, scheduling, correspondence, and reporting, helping the wider team operate efficiently.

Key Responsibilities

  • Manage internal documentation, filing, and digital records accurately
  • Schedule meetings, prepare agendas, and circulate notes where required
  • Handle inbound correspondence and route enquiries to relevant teams
  • Prepare reports, spreadsheets, and basic data summaries
  • Maintain accurate records within internal systems and CRMs
  • Support team-wide administrative tasks and ad-hoc projects
  • Follow agreed processes and service standards consistently

What We're Looking For

  • Previous experience in an administrative, office support, or similar role
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ills in English
  • Good attention to detail and accuracy in document handling
  • Confident with Microsoft Office, Google Workspace, and cloud-based systems
  • Ability to manage multiple tasks without compromising quality
  • Reliable and self-motivated when working remotely
  • A stable home internet connection and a quiet workspace

How to prepare for a job interview at VITA CV

Know Your Stuff

Before the interview, make sure you understand the role of an Administrative Assistant inside out. Familiarise yourself with document management, scheduling, and the tools mentioned in the job description like Microsoft Office and Google Workspace. This will help you answer questions confidently and show that you're ready to hit the ground running.

Show Off Your Communication Skills

Since strong written and verbal communication skills are key for this role, prepare examples of how you've effectively communicated in previous positions. Whether it’s handling correspondence or preparing reports, be ready to discuss specific instances where your communication made a difference.

Demonstrate Attention to Detail

In administrative roles, accuracy is crucial. Bring along examples of your work that showcase your attention to detail, like well-organised documents or error-free reports. You might even want to mention any systems you’ve used to ensure accuracy in your previous jobs.

Prepare for Remote Work Questions

Since this is a remote position, be prepared to discuss your home office setup and how you manage your time and tasks independently. Highlight your reliability and self-motivation, and maybe share a few tips on how you stay organised while working from home.
